DEATHS.
MACKAY.—On the 3rd May, 1916, at Rafflestreet, Napier, Henry Mackay,- the beloved husband ot Agnes Mackay. LUKE.—On the 4th May, 1916, at No. 5, Mortimer-terrace, William George, the beloved husband of Ellen. Luke, and father and father-in-law of E. M. Jones; aged M years. So loved, so mourned. MEYERS.—On the 4th May, at Kilbirnie. Edith Alice, beloved youngest daughter of Mrs.- M. McCaull, and the late H. M. - McCaull, M.A. THORPE.—On the 6th May, at her son-in-law's residence, No. 5, Tonks Grove, Wellington, Ann, relict of the late Richard Thorpe; aged 78 years. West Coast papers please copy.
